About St Paul's Episcopal Church
St. Paul's Episcopal Church in Exton, Pennsylvania, is part of the Anglican tradition with roots in centuries of liturgical worship and spiritual community. As an Episcopal congregation, the church embraces inclusive theology, welcoming people from diverse backgrounds and walks of life. The parish is committed to serving both its members and the broader Exton community through worship, pastoral care, and Christian service. Visitors to St. Paul's will experience a worship tradition that values both reverence and contemporary relevance, with a focus on Scripture, sacrament, and community connection. The church invites all who seek spiritual growth and fellowship to join in its worship and ministries.
First-Time Visitor Info for St Paul's Episcopal Church
Dress Code: Not specified — please contact the church directly. Service Format: Most Episcopal services feature liturgical worship with responsive readings, hymns, and Holy Communion as a central element. Visitor Tips: Newcomers are encouraged to arrive a few minutes early to find a seat and receive a bulletin; ushers are happy to assist with navigating the service.
